Our client in Brussels is looking for a Backend Developer who will have the following tasks:
* Development of back-end website applications.
* Implement core business logic.
* Creation of servers and databases for functionality.
* Understanding and implementation of security and data protection.
* Cross-platform optimization.
* Design responsive applications.
* Design and develop APIs.
* Participating in the design and creation of scalable software.
* Taking lead on projects, as needed.
* Maintenance of code integrity and organization.
* Writing clean, functional code for the back-end and possibly front-end applications.
* Compile and analyze data, processes, and codes to troubleshoot problems and identify areas for improvement.
* Testing and fixing bugs or other coding issues.
* Meet both technical and consumer needs.
* Write technical documentation.
KNOWLEDGE AND SKILLS
* Experience in Java 8+, Spring, Spring Boot, Java EE.
* Experience in Oracle Service Bus.
* Experience in OpenID Connect integration.
* Experience in SSO.
* Experience in Cloud development with Amazon web services.
* Knowledge on API GW configuration with OAuth 2.
* Knowledge on Oracle WebLogic Server, Apache.
* Knowledge on SSL/TLS Protocol configuration in application servers.
* Knowledge on reverse proxy configuration.
* Experience in Kafka and JMS.
* Experience in Oracle DB.
* Experience with REST and SOAP services.
* Knowledge on CI/CD pipelines.
* Knowledge of development, building and deployment of micro services.
* Experience with tools for web services testing (SOAPUI, ReadyAPI, Postman)".
* Bachelor’s level or 3 years of higher education.
CONDITIONS
* Freelance contract.
* Location near Brussels (must live within an hour by train from the workplace).